Method
1. The student put masses on the sledge and pulled it gently with a Newton metre, to measure the
force needed until it just started to move. (Force is measured in units called Newtons or N.)
2. The student recorded the force shown by the Newton metre which was needed to move the sledge.
3. Extra masses were then added to the sledge to make it heavier.
4. The student recorded the force needed to move the heavier sledge.
5. The student collected 5 sets of results, using different masses.
